Did you know?

Perennial hibiscus are the very last thing to come up in the spring, sometimes not sprouting until the beginning of June. This wonderful late summer/fall bloomer is well worth having . . . just be patient.

Dear Pickles & Pepper:

My combo containers never look good. What should I do?

Signed:
"Mombo Jombo Combo "

Dear "Mombo:"
My owners say a successful container garden comes from good soil, good fertilizer, and the right plants. Plants should be well matched in water and light requirements to grow well together. They can help you with this.
